How many mpg will you save by changing your fuel filter?

Just changed my fuel filter on 1994 crown victoria 4.6l V8 I think it was the first time it has been changed it has 120.000 miles on it the old filter was very dirty thick black stuff in it.|||HI


You well see NO Mileage improvement with a fuel filter change.. but it well save the fuel pump from working so hard and you won%26#039;t get a lean condition that can burn a hole in a piston. Now an air filter change can give a little better MPG if the one on it is dirty cause the motor well breath better.Thur and clean filter.
